Charlie Sheehy Has Signed A Long-Term
Promotional Deal With Eddie Hearn and Matchroom!
(April 15th) Charlie Sheehy has steadily positioned himself as one of the most promising American lightweight prospects, combining a decorated amateur pedigree with an unbeaten professional run and growing promotional backing. In 2024, Sheehy signed a long-term deal with Eddie Hearn’s Matchroom Boxing, marking a significant step in his career and a return to the platform where he first turned professional.
A native of Brisbane, California, Sheehy was introduced to boxing at a young age at the Fire in the Ring gym in San Francisco. Training in a notoriously tight, unconventional space, where the ring had ropes on only two sides, helped shape his aggressive confidence and adaptability. Reflecting on those early conditions, Sheehy said, “It taught me to keep fighting and be confident in myself and let my hands go. When I finally got into a full-sized ring for a fight, I felt like I had all the room in the world.” Under the guidance of longtime coach Miguel Rios, he developed a technically refined style rooted in discipline, ring awareness, and sharp combination punching.
Sheehy’s amateur career ranks among the most accomplished of his generation in the United States. He captured 17 national titles, including multiple National Golden Gloves and National PAL championships, and represented Team USA in international competition. His résumé includes notable wins over future world-class fighters such as Ryan Garcia and Vergil Ortiz Jr. At the 2020 U.S. Olympic Trials, Sheehy advanced to the medal rounds before losing a competitive decision to eventual Olympic silver medalist Keyshawn Davis, later serving as an Olympic alternate at 138 pounds.
Turning professional in October 2021, Sheehy debuted in Fresno, California on a Matchroom card headlined by Mikey Garcia vs. Sandor Martin. He quickly built momentum in the paid ranks, gaining experience on major platforms and progressing through increasingly seasoned opposition. By November 2024, Sheehy had improved his record to 12–0 with nine knockouts, highlighted by a stoppage victory over D’Angelo Keyes in Fresno—a symbolic full-circle moment in the same city where his professional journey began.
The new promotional agreement signals a pivotal phase in his career. “I am very excited to sign with Matchroom,” said Sheehy. “I made my pro debut with Matchroom five years ago and always felt it was where I belonged. I believe in this platform and my team. Now, it's time to prove I belong on the world stage.” He added, “I want to thank Eddie Hearn and Peter Kahn for getting this done and my team, Mike Bazzel, Javiel Centeno and Bruno Escalante for continuing to put in the work with me.”
Promoter Eddie Hearn echoed that confidence in Sheehy’s trajectory. “Charlie is a fantastic addition to the stable,” said Hearn. “With his impressive amateur standing and solid base in the pro game, he’s ready to kick on now to start making moves and getting himself into the rankings and in range to make some real noise at 135lbs. We’ll be announcing Charlie’s first fight with us soon, which will be his first ten round bout and will take place on one of our stacked summer slate of shows.”
With a strong amateur foundation, an unblemished record, and renewed promotional momentum, Sheehy is widely regarded as a “blue-chip” lightweight prospect entering contention territory. His blend of technical skill, ring IQ, and developing power positions him as part of the next wave of American fighters aiming to make a decisive impact on the world stage.

About Matchroom Boxing
After the success of snooker in the 1980s, Matchroom Sport moved into boxing with two small hall shows followed by Frank Bruno v Joe Bugner at Tottenham Hotspur’s ground – the biggest boxing event of 1987. That launched the company into the boxing big-time, a position it has maintained ever since.
Through the 1990s Matchroom Sport’s boxing roster featured many of the biggest names in the sport including Lennox Lewis, Nigel Benn, Chris Eubank, Steve Collins and Naseem Hamed, all in world title fights and it continues to work with some of the biggest names in UK boxing including Audley Harrison, the 2000 Olympic Super-Heavyweight gold medalist.
Over the years, Matchroom Sport has built up long-standing relationships with broadcasters around the world and with the advent of the Prizefighter phenomenon, the company’s boxing division has never been in a stronger position.
